Achieving the Art of Proofreading

Proofreading serves as a crucial stage in the writing cycle. It demands a keen attention to detail and the capacity to spot even delicate errors.

A thorough proofreader scrutinizes the text for grammatical inaccuracies, lexicographical mistakes, and inconsistencies in style. By methodically reviewing each sentence, a proofreader ensures the precision and credibility of the final piece.

Refining this craft takes time, practice, and a committed approach. Here are some tips to improve your proofreading proficiency:

  • Scrutinize the text aloud for the purpose of catch any awkward phrasing or errors that might be skipped when reading silently.
  • Step away from the text occasionally to rejuvenate your focus and perspective.
  • Employ proofreading tools and resources to assist in identifying common errors.
